    What Is The Best Time To Visit Bruges – Discover Ideal Timing

    AvatarBy Lindsey TramutaMay 7, 2025No Comments6 Mins Read
    Share
    Facebook Twitter Reddit Telegram Pinterest Email

    Bruges, a captivating city in Belgium, often referred to as the “Venice of the North,” is a treasure trove of medieval architecture, charming canals, and a rich history. Planning a trip to this enchanting destination requires careful consideration of the best time to visit. The weather, crowds, and seasonal events all play a role in shaping your Bruges experience. Choosing the right time can significantly enhance your enjoyment and ensure you make the most of your visit.

    This comprehensive guide will delve into the nuances of each season, providing valuable insights into the pros and cons of visiting Bruges at different times of the year. From the vibrant blooms of spring to the festive cheer of Christmas, we’ll explore the unique charm that each season brings to this captivating city.

    Spring in Bruges (March – May)

    Spring awakens Bruges with a burst of color and life. The days grow longer, the sun shines brighter, and the city comes alive with a renewed energy. Temperatures are mild, averaging between 10°C and 18°C (50°F and 64°F), making it pleasant for exploring the cobblestone streets and canals.

    Blooming Beauty

    One of the most enchanting aspects of spring in Bruges is the abundance of flowers. The city’s parks and gardens burst into bloom, showcasing a kaleidoscope of colors. The Beguinage, a historic convent complex, is particularly stunning during this season, with its charming flower-filled courtyards.

    Festivals and Events

    Spring is a time for festivals and celebrations in Bruges. The annual Bruges Beer Festival, held in April, is a must-visit for beer enthusiasts, featuring a wide selection of Belgian brews. The Bruges Triennial, a contemporary art exhibition, also takes place in the spring, showcasing the works of talented artists from around the world.

    Crowds and Accommodation

    As spring approaches, Bruges becomes increasingly popular with tourists. Accommodation prices tend to rise, so it’s advisable to book in advance. The city can be quite crowded, especially during weekends and holidays.

    Summer in Bruges (June – August)

    Summer in Bruges is a time for outdoor enjoyment. The weather is warm and sunny, with average temperatures ranging from 18°C to 25°C (64°F to 77°F). The long daylight hours allow for ample time to explore the city’s many attractions.

    Canal Cruises and Outdoor Dining

    Summer is the perfect time to enjoy a leisurely canal cruise, taking in the picturesque views of Bruges’ canals and historic buildings. Outdoor cafes and restaurants are in full swing, offering a delightful ambiance for dining al fresco. (See Also: Best Time of Year to Visit Cades Cove – A Perfect Fall Getaway)

    Festivals and Markets

    Bruges hosts a variety of festivals and markets during the summer months. The Markt, the city’s main square, comes alive with vibrant stalls selling local crafts, souvenirs, and delicacies. The Bruges Summer Festival, a celebration of music and culture, takes place in July and August.

    Crowds and Accommodation

    Summer is peak season in Bruges, with large crowds and high accommodation prices. It’s essential to book your flights, accommodation, and tours well in advance to secure your preferred dates and avoid disappointment.

    Autumn in Bruges (September – November)

    Autumn paints Bruges in a palette of warm hues. The leaves turn vibrant shades of red, orange, and yellow, creating a stunning backdrop for exploring the city. Temperatures are mild, ranging from 10°C to 15°C (50°F to 59°F).

    Crisp Air and Cozy Ambiance

    The crisp autumn air adds a touch of magic to Bruges. The city’s historic buildings and cobblestone streets take on a particularly charming appearance during this season. Cozy cafes and pubs invite you to relax with a warm drink and enjoy the autumnal atmosphere.

    Festivals and Events

    Autumn in Bruges is marked by several cultural events. The Bruges Film Festival, a showcase of international cinema, takes place in October. The Bruges Chocolate Festival, a celebration of Belgium’s beloved confectionery, is a sweet treat for chocolate lovers.

    Crowds and Accommodation

    Autumn sees fewer crowds compared to summer, making it a more relaxed time to visit Bruges. Accommodation prices are also generally lower.

    Winter in Bruges (December – February)

    Winter in Bruges transforms the city into a magical wonderland. Snowflakes may fall, blanketing the canals and cobblestone streets in a pristine white. The festive season brings a special charm to the city. (See Also: How Much Time To Visit Statue Of Liberty?)

    Christmas Markets and Festive Cheer

    Bruges is renowned for its enchanting Christmas markets. Stalls selling traditional crafts, ornaments, and festive treats line the Markt and other squares. The aroma of roasted chestnuts and mulled wine fills the air, creating a truly festive ambiance.

    Ice Skating and Winter Activities

    During the winter months, an ice skating rink is set up on the Markt, offering a fun activity for all ages. Horse-drawn carriage rides are also popular, allowing you to enjoy the city’s winter beauty from a cozy vantage point.

    Crowds and Accommodation

    Winter is a popular time to visit Bruges, especially during the Christmas season. Accommodation prices tend to be higher, so it’s advisable to book in advance.

    What Is the Best Time to Visit Bruges?

    The best time to visit Bruges depends on your personal preferences and priorities. Each season offers a unique experience, with its own set of advantages and disadvantages.

    • Spring (March – May): Ideal for those who enjoy mild weather, blooming flowers, and a vibrant atmosphere.
    • Summer (June – August): Perfect for outdoor activities, canal cruises, and festivals.
    • Autumn (September – November): Offers a charming ambiance, crisp air, and fewer crowds.
    • Winter (December – February): Magical for Christmas markets, festive cheer, and a snowy landscape.

    Ultimately, the best time to visit Bruges is whenever it suits your travel plans and interests.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    What is the weather like in Bruges in the summer?

    Summer in Bruges is warm and sunny, with average temperatures ranging from 18°C to 25°C (64°F to 77°F). It’s the perfect time for outdoor activities and enjoying the city’s many attractions. (See Also: Best Time to Visit Ausable Chasm – A Year Round Guide)

    Is Bruges expensive to visit?

    Bruges can be considered a moderately priced destination. Accommodation, food, and transportation costs can vary depending on the time of year and your travel style. However, there are plenty of budget-friendly options available, such as hostels, guesthouses, and street food stalls.

    How many days should I spend in Bruges?

    Most visitors spend 2-3 days in Bruges to fully explore its highlights. However, if you have more time, you can easily spend a week or more in the city and its surrounding areas.

    What is the best way to get around Bruges?

    Bruges is a very walkable city, with most of its attractions within easy walking distance. You can also explore the canals by boat or rent a bicycle.

    Are there any free things to do in Bruges?

    Yes, there are many free things to do in Bruges, such as strolling through the Markt, visiting the Beguinage, and exploring the city’s parks and gardens.
